IMPROVING INFECTION

CONTROL TRAINING

The software is designed to accurately model hazards such as radiation contamination or biohazards. It can model, track and visualise these invisible hazards to create a unique training simulation that it is impossible to replicate in real life without risk to personnel.

The software is used to train nuclear power plant workers as well as hospital workers and is available in both nuclear and clinical formats. Its tracking system covertly logs if contaminated surfaces have been touched and where that contamination may have spread.  Its radiation modelling also includes radiation ‘shine’ based upon a range of source terms and allows for shielding attenuation.

As well as hazard simulation it also replicates a range of Personal Protective Equipment (PPE) including radiation dosemeters.

TRAINING ACROSS NHS TRUSTS

NCORA was developed with Torbay and South Devon NHS Foundation Trust and University Hospitals Plymouth NHS Trust to modernise infection control education.
The system provides practical training in:
• Hygiene protocols
• Hazard identification
• Correct PPE selection and sequence of use
 
Early deployment has shown improved adherence to infection control standards and greater staff confidence when applying procedures in live clinical environments.
